Handling Daily Treatment Tasks





Handling daily care jobs is an important aspect of at home treatment that guarantees individuals obtain the support they require to maintain their wellness and independence. Caretakers play an important duty in assisting with activities of day-to-day like this living (ADLs), that include showering, dressing, grooming, and dish preparation. By taking on these duties, caregivers assist reduce the physical and psychological problems that households may deal with while looking after their loved ones.


Along with individual treatment, caretakers are likewise charged with drug administration, guaranteeing that customers follow prescribed routines and does. This oversight is important for preserving wellness and avoiding negative effects from missed or inaccurate drugs. In addition, caregivers typically help with movement, giving assistance for customers relocating around their homes, therefore reducing the danger of falls and improving general security.
